NT Bureau
Chennai, May 23:
The Tamiladu State Council of Confederation of Indian Industry (CII) today welcomed the two important announcements made by Chief Minister M Karunanidhi on the expansion of Chennai Airport and the setting up of a new Greenfield Airport near Chennai.
In a statement Gopal Srinivasan, chairman, CII said, 'CII welcomes and fully supports this bold twin track move by Chief Minister that will secure a quick medium term win, while creating a bold option for next decade in the new airport location.
This is exactly in line with the CII recommendation submitted to the Tamilnadu Government earlier.
The Chief Minister has taken an important step forward for sustaining the economic momentum of the State and Chennai in particular.'
The expansion plan of the Chennai Airport, in the medium term, would ease the passenger traffic, which is expected to touch 12-13 million by 2011, added Srinivasan.
Gopal Srinivasan thanked Chief Minister for accepting the CII recommendation to expand the existing airport initially and look at developing a greenfield airport in a long term perspective.
This landmark twin announcements
made today reinstates the commitment of the Government of Tamilnadu in
providing world class infrastructure in making Tamilnadu a front-runner
in economic development.
